
Air pollution control technology provider Scheuch has appointed a new COO, Heinz Autischer, taking over Jörg Jeliniewski. Autischer will join CEO Stefan Scheuch and CFO Thomas Eberl as the management of Scheuch Group.
Autischer has years of management experience in the Andritz Group in various business areas and divisions, including as global head of Andritz Metals. He has also spent several years in Brazil as managing director for Andritz Hydro and several years in Germany for Andritz Maerz, an industrial furnace manufacturer for the steel industry. Most recently, he was chief automation officer at Andritz Group in Vienna.
In his new position, he will be the third managing director of Scheuch Management Holding and, as COO of the Scheuch Group, will be responsible for managing the four business units of the Scheuch Group as well as the Group Production & Operations, Innovation Management & Business Development and Digitalisation departments.
